Until I tasted this dish at a friend's house, I wouldn't eat okra, as I always found it to have a slimy texture. But this dish isn't slimy. This wonderful dish is healthy and low cal, and is so easy to prepare. It makes a great side. I omit the sugar, and add a little dried oregano and/or basil, which gives it a little extra zing. It also works fine with ham if you don't have bacon - just saute with the onion and garlic.
